【问题标题】:Adding site Binding programmatically IIS 7.5以编程方式添加站点绑定 IIS 7.5
【发布时间】:2015-08-23 14:30:53
【问题描述】:

我正在尝试以编程方式添加站点绑定。这是我的代码:

using (ServerManager manager = ServerManager.OpenRemote("serverName"))
{
    manager.Sites["siteName"].Bindings.Add(string.Format("*:{1}:{0}.localhost", clientCode, port), "http");
    manager.CommitChanges();
}

我收到以下错误。我该如何解决这个问题?

UnAuthorizedException:由于以下错误,从机器检索具有 CLSID {} 的远程组件的 COM 类工厂失败:80070005

【问题讨论】:

    标签: c# iis


    【解决方案1】:

    运行代码的账号必须是远程机器的管理员,并且远程机器上的DCOM相关端口必须在防火墙打开。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2012-03-14
      • 2023-03-28
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多